Abstract

An exhaust gas treating apparatus removes nitrogen oxides and mercury in exhaust gas from a boiler using an ammonia denitration catalyst, including: an ammonium chloride powder feed unit for feeding ammonium chloride, in powder form, into a vicinity of an entrance of an economizer provided to a combustion gas flue of the boiler and/or an economizer bypass unit, the fed ammonium chloride in powder form being sublimed by a combustion gas, to thereby feed hydrogen chloride and ammonia into the flue; and an ammonium chloride liquid feed unit for feeding ammonium chloride, in liquid form, into a vicinity of the entrance of the economizer and/or the economizer bypass unit, the ammonium chloride liquid feed unit also being capable of feeding ammonium chloride, vaporization of the fed ammonium chloride in liquid form by the combustion gas also allowing hydrogen chloride and ammonia to be fed into the flue.
